US Households' Stock Allocation Drops 1.3% in Q1 2025: Implications for Crypto Market and Investment Flows
According to The Kobeissi Letter, US households' allocation to stocks declined by 1.3 percentage points in Q1 2025, reaching 43.1%, the lowest since Q1 2024 and marking the largest quarterly drop since the 2022 bear market (source: The Kobeissi Letter, June 19, 2025). This notable shift in equity allocation signals increased risk aversion among retail investors, which could trigger further diversification into alternative assets like cryptocurrencies.
